Baloise Belgium Tour: Jenno Berckmoes in Tears After Winning Stage 4 as Ethan Hayter Loses Race Lead by Four Seconds

Summary by Cycling News
Hilly stage in the Ardennes shakes-up GC before final stage around Brussels

Belgian Jenno Berckmoes (Lotto) beat his breakaway companions at the end of the 4th stage of the Tour de Belgique this Saturday. Filippo Baroncini took the lead of the general for four seconds ahead of Ethan Hayter.
